Con Kolivas wrote:
> This patchset is designed to improve system responsiveness and interactivity. 
> It is configurable to any workload but the default -ck patch is aimed at the 
> desktop and -cks is available with more emphasis on serverspace.

Hi all,

  i am using this patch for the first time and i am reporting my experience.

   Before this patch with all the programs i usually keep running 
(opera/iceweasel with lots of tabs, icedove mail client, konversation 
irc client, akregator feed reader, and the super-hog second life client, 
vim, among others) the reponse was a bit slugish (waiting for program 
focus, wait for redrawing specially when i change from one virtual 
desktop to another).

   After I started using this patch the response/interactivity seems 
improved and faster, i never used Linux so responsive as now. I can 
switch between virtual desktops with immediate response. Even with a 
load of 2.0 (now, while i am writing this) thse system it's very 
responsive and the audio and video still work without glitches.

Just for the record, and if it matters i am using it on a laptop with a 
T2500 CPU, 1 GB RAM.
